### Catalog cache invalidation (Wrenmark)

The Wrenmark product catalog caches listing pages at the edge with a 10-minute TTL, but price and stock changes trigger explicit invalidation through the purge queue. As a contractor, never call the purge API directly — enqueue through the catalog service so dedupe and rate limits apply. Stale pages usually mean the queue consumer is behind. Architecture notes, purge semantics, and debugging steps are collected on the internal page below.

dashboard of yahaf-kajep = https://jira.zemvarsys.internal/display/projects/browse/browse/a08b

Minutes — Management Meeting, Branch Managers' Call

Topic: Term sheet from Corvalane Partners

Pieter walked us through the draft term sheet — broadly what we expected, though the exclusivity clause runs longer than we'd like. Legal will push back on that and the renewal trigger. Branch managers should hold off on any Corvalane co-marketing until signing. The rationale behind our negotiating position is noted below.

confidential, bafop-kahag: Gross margin on Ulawyn came in at 15 percent against a plan of 10 percent. Only 5 of the 80 pilot accounts renewed Ulawyn, so a churn review is set for January 1.

Recovery procedure: first confirm the scheduler daemon is healthy and no watering jobs are mid-run, since recovery forces a queue flush and dry pots make customers unhappy. Then open the recovery console from an allow-listed host, verify the account owner with the team lead, and document the incident. Finally, authorize the reset using the recovery passphrase below.

unlock words, hahip-baduf: holwyn-istath-julvan

// Per-tenant rate quota client.
// Talks to the Quotable internal service, which owns all tenant
// quota state. Never cache quota decisions locally; limits change
// mid-window when tenants upgrade. Timeouts fail open at the gateway,
// so keep the deadline short (200ms). One client per process — the
// service tracks connections per key. Auth uses a quota-service
// credential, set directly below.

service key, fawip-bajef: kto11_Qt5wZK9vdNC